python
oracle字符串拆分转义?
一、oracle字符串拆分转义?
wm_concat非标准函数,不保证以后会支持
标准写法:
with t as (select name,row_number() over(order by name) rn from 表)
select name, rn, sys_connect_by_path(name, ',') path
from t
start with rn=1 connect by prior rn+1=rn
二、jquery 字符串转义
jQuery 字符串转义及应用
在前端开发中,处理字符串是非常常见的操作之一。而当我们使用 jQuery 进行开发时,经常会遇到需要对字符串进行转义的情况。本文将重点讨论 jQuery 中的字符串转义方法以及其在实际开发中的应用。
什么是字符串转义
字符串转义是指将字符串中的特殊字符转换为它们的转义序列的过程。在程序中,一些字符具有特殊含义,如果直接使用可能会导致意外结果或错误,因此需要对这些字符进行转义处理。
jQuery 中的字符串转义方法
在 jQuery 中,通过使用 $.escapeSelector() 方法可以对字符串中的特殊字符进行转义处理。该方法可以确保字符串中的特殊字符不会被误解为选择器或其他意外的操作。
示例:
var selector = '$$#selector';
var escapedSelector = $.escapeSelector(selector);
// 输出结果:"\$\$\#selector"
字符串转义的应用场景
字符串转义在实际开发中有着广泛的应用场景,特别是在处理用户输入内容时更为重要。以下是一些常见的应用场景:
- 1. 用户输入处理:当用户输入内容可能包含特殊字符时,需要对其进行转义处理,以避免安全漏洞或其他问题。
- 2. DOM 操作:在使用 jQuery 进行 DOM 操作时,如果某些选择器需要包含特殊字符,可以先对其进行转义处理以确保正常使用。
- 3. AJAX 请求:在发送 AJAX 请求时,URL 参数中可能包含特殊字符,需要对其进行转义以确保传递正确的参数。
总结
字符串转义在前端开发中起着至关重要的作用,能够确保程序的正常运行和安全性。在使用 jQuery 进行开发时,合理地利用字符串转义方法可以有效避免潜在的问题,提高代码的健壮性和可维护性。
三、字符串转义 json
字符串转义 json
在处理JSON数据时,经常会遇到需要对字符串进行转义的情况。字符串转义是指将特殊字符转换为转义序列,以便在不同环境下能够正确地解析和显示这些特殊字符。在JSON中,字符串转义是十分常见的操作,特别是在处理包含特殊字符的JSON数据时。
什么是字符串转义?
字符串转义是指将特殊字符转换为转义序列的过程。在JSON中,常见的特殊字符包括双引号、反斜杠、斜杠、换行符等。通过字符串转义,可以确保这些特殊字符在JSON数据中被正确地处理和解析。
例如,如果一个字符串包含双引号字符,那么在JSON中需要对双引号进行转义,将其转换为\",以确保JSON解析器能够正确地识别和处理这个字符串。
为什么需要字符串转义?
在JSON中,特殊字符如双引号、反斜杠等在字符串中具有特殊意义。为了确保字符串在JSON数据中能够正确地表示并解析,需要对这些特殊字符进行转义处理。否则,这些特殊字符可能会导致JSON解析错误,使得数据无法正常显示或处理。
如何进行字符串转义?
在处理JSON数据时,常见的字符串转义方法包括使用反斜杠来转义特殊字符。例如,要将双引号转义为\",将反斜杠转义为\\。这样可以确保JSON解析器能够正确地识别和处理这些特殊字符。
除了手动转义外,许多编程语言和JSON库都提供了字符串转义的功能,可以自动帮助开发者处理字符串中的特殊字符。通过调用相应的转义函数或方法,可以简化字符串转义的过程,提高开发效率。
如何正确处理转义后的字符串?
一旦完成字符串转义,就需要确保转义后的字符串能够被正确地解析和处理。在解析JSON数据时,应当使用专门的JSON解析器,避免手动解析JSON字符串,以免出现意外错误。
另外,在构建包含转义字符串的JSON数据时,需要确保每个特殊字符都被正确地转义,以免导致格式错误或解析问题。通过严谨的转义处理,可以保证JSON数据的完整性和准确性。
总结
字符串转义是处理JSON数据中特殊字符的重要操作,可以确保数据在不同环境下能够正确地解析和显示。通过适当的字符串转义,可以避免JSON解析错误,提高数据处理的准确性和稳定性。
在处理JSON数据时,开发者应当熟练掌握字符串转义的方法和技巧,以保证数据处理的准确性和高效性。
希望本文对您有所帮助,感谢阅读!
四、jquery 字符串 转义
使用 jQuery 实现字符串转义功能
jQuery 是一款流行的 JavaScript 库,广泛用于网页开发中。在开发过程中,经常会遇到需要对字符串进行转义的情况,以防止潜在的安全漏洞或错误展示。本文将介绍如何利用 jQuery 实现字符串转义功能,保障网站的安全性和稳定性。
什么是字符串转义
字符串转义是指将特殊字符转换为它们对应的转义序列的过程。在网页开发中,特殊字符可能会被浏览器误解,导致意外行为或代码执行问题。因此,对输入的字符串进行转义是一个重要的安全措施,尤其是涉及用户输入的场景。
jQuery 字符串转义方法
jQuery 提供了多种方法来实现字符串的转义,其中一个常用的方法是使用 .text()
函数。这个函数可以帮助我们将字符串中的特殊字符进行转义,避免在网页上渲染时出现问题。
以下是一个简单的例子,演示如何使用 .text()
函数对字符串进行转义:
var userInput = "<script>alert('XSS Attack!')</script>";
var escapedString = $("").text(userInput).html();
console.log(escapedString); // 输出:<script>alert('XSS Attack!')</script>
字符串转义的重要性
字符串转义在网页开发中占据着重要的地位。未经转义的字符串可能会导致跨站脚本攻击(XSS)等安全漏洞,从而使网站遭受恶意攻击。通过对用户输入进行适当的转义处理,可以有效预防此类安全问题的产生。
结语
通过本文的介绍,我们了解了在网页开发中如何利用 jQuery 实现字符串转义,保护网站的安全性。在开发过程中,始终要注意用户输入的有效性,并对需要展示的字符串进行适当的转义处理,确保网站的正常运行和用户数据的安全性。
五、json 字符串 转义
JSON 字符串转义指南
在处理 JSON 数据时,经常会遇到需要对字符串中的特殊字符进行转义的情况。本文将为您介绍如何有效地转义 JSON 字符串,以确保数据的准确性和安全性。
JSON(JavaScript Object Notation)是一种轻量级数据交换格式,广泛应用于前端与后端之间的数据传输和存储。在 JSON 字符串中,某些字符需要进行转义才能正确表示,以避免解析时出现错误。
什么是 JSON 字符串
JSON 字符串是一种由键值对构成的文本格式,用于表示结构化数据。在 JSON 字符串中,字符串值必须用双引号括起来,而且部分特殊字符需要被转义,以保证数据的完整性。
为何需要转义 JSON 字符串
在 JSON 字符串中,特定的字符需要被转义,因为它们可能与字符串的标记符号相冲突,导致解析错误。常见需要转义的字符包括双引号、反斜杠、换行符等。
如何进行 JSON 字符串转义
JSON 字符串转义的方法主要是通过在特殊字符前添加反斜杠来实现。例如,要表示双引号字符,可以使用 \" 进行转义,表示反斜杠字符则需用 \\ 进行转义。
以下是一些常见的 JSON 字符串转义示例:
- 双引号: \"
- 反斜杠: \\
- 斜杠: \\/
- 换行符: \\n
注意事项
在处理 JSON 字符串转义时,需要格外小心,确保转义前后的字符串格式正确,并避免出现意外的转义字符,以免影响数据的正确性和解析结果。
总的来说,正确地处理 JSON 字符串转义是保证数据传输和解析准确性的重要环节,合理使用转义字符可以有效避免不必要的问题。
希望本文对您在处理 JSON 字符串转义时有所帮助,祝您顺利处理数据,确保系统稳定运行。
六、python字符串不转义原样输出的参数的全称是?
python可以使用repr()函数输出原始字符串(不转义)。
七、python字符串替换?
在Python中,字符串替换可以通过使用replace()方法来实现。这个方法接受两个参数,第一个参数是要被替换的子字符串,第二个参数是用来替换的新字符串。
例如,如果我们有一个字符串s,想要将其中的所有"apple"替换为"banana",可以使用s.replace("apple", "banana")来实现。另外,我们也可以使用正则表达式来进行复杂的字符串替换操作。总之,Python提供了多种灵活的方式来进行字符串替换,让我们能够轻松地对字符串进行操作和处理。
八、python中如何去掉字符串中的数字?
str = 'a1b2c3-)'print filter(lambda x:x not in '0123456789',str)
九、python字符串转时间?
import pandas as pd
import time
time1="2020-12-12 12:12:12"
pd.to_date(time1)
十、python怎么分割字符串?
固定长度分割,直接通过[:3] 这种来取。
固定分隔符一般用split
看你需求,其他的方式也有。最好有个例子。
热点信息
-
在Python中,要查看函数的用法,可以使用以下方法: 1. 使用内置函数help():在Python交互式环境中,可以直接输入help(函数名)来获取函数的帮助文档。例如,...
-
一、java 连接数据库 在当今信息时代,Java 是一种广泛应用的编程语言,尤其在与数据库进行交互的过程中发挥着重要作用。无论是在企业级应用开发还是...
-
一、idea连接mysql数据库 php connect_error) { die("连接失败: " . $conn->connect_error);}echo "成功连接到MySQL数据库!";// 关闭连接$conn->close();?> 二、idea连接mysql数据库连...
-
要在Python中安装modbus-tk库,您可以按照以下步骤进行操作: 1. 确保您已经安装了Python解释器。您可以从Python官方网站(https://www.python.org)下载和安装最新版本...